We hope you guys totally enjoyed watching episode 6 tonight, especially since episode 6 was indeed the last episode for this current, premiere season 1 of The Walking Dead: Dead City. That’s right, guys. AMC only greenlit 6 episodes for this first season. So, that is it. You won’t see another new episode of The Walking Dead: Dead City for a while.

The good news is that we can officially tell you that you will get to see another new episode of The Walking Dead: Dead City at some point in the future because AMC did renew it for a brand new season 2.

According to the folks over at TVLine.com ,” AMC announced the season 2 renewal just a couple of days ago on July 21, 2023. They also mentioned that AMC decided to go ahead and renew the Daryl Dixon Walking Dead spinoff series for a new season 2 even though it hasn’t even premiered yet. It’s scheduled to start up on Sunday night, September 10, 2023.

During the renewal announcement of The Walking Dead: Dead City and Daryl Dixon Walking Dead spinoffs, the president of entertainment and AMC Studios for AMC Networks Dan McDermott had some very positive and enthusiastic things to say about these new shows stating,”This next chapter in the Walking Dead Universe continues to thrive with a terrific inaugural season for Dead City and highly anticipated new journey for fan-favorite character Daryl Dixon.

We can’t wait to bring Dead City fans back to the epicenter of Manhattan for more zip-lining action with Maggie and Negan. And, ahead of its debut, we’re thrilled to double down on Daryl as we bring the apocalypse to France, transforming Notre Dame, Pont du Gard and other iconic locales into an apocalyptic landscape unlike anything we’ve seen before.”

According to the LIVE Nielsen Ratings, The Walking Dead: Dead City season 1 averaged 698,000 LIVE viewers per episode, and a 0.14 ratings score for the 18-49 year old demographics. The most recent episode 5, which aired last Sunday night, July 16, 2023, managed to draw in 701,000 LIVE viewers, and a 0.12 ratings score.

The most-viewed episode was episode 2 with 706,000 LIVE viewers. The least-viewed episode was episode 3 with 681,000 LIVE viewers. The highest-rated episode was the premiere episode 1 with a 0.17 ratings score. The lowest-rated episode was episode 5 with a 0.12 ratings score. We’re pretty sure that after tacking on the numbers from the streaming platforms, the numbers are at least double those amounts.
